The key features of FileMaker Pro 10 Advanced
• Custom Menus - Customize menus by script on models, or by renaming some menu items, add or delete, or replace the entire menu.
• Import of tables - create and update databases faster by importing multiple tables at once.
• Script Debugger - Check your script step by step to inform you in detail about script calls and follow the script finishes.
• Data Display - Check the calculation formulas without database changes. The data display shows field values, variables and expressions.
• Runtime Maker - Create standalone runtime applications that are executable without FileMaker Pro.
• Kiosk Maker - Create a database application, the user interface menus to hide. This is particularly useful if users are to carry out mailing lists and event registrations themselves.
• User-defined functions - Use custom functions in your database as often. If you update functions, the changes are automatically global.
• External plug-in API programming - Expand with more reliable methods of calculating the potential of data usage.
• Database Design Report - Create comprehensive reports containing information on all elements of your database schema -. Including boxes, tables and custom menus.
• PHP Site Assistant to call - the PHP Site Assistant in FileMaker Server to start directly with a command in the menu "Tools".
System Requirements
Operating system
• Mac OS X 10.5 PowerPC G4 (867MHz +), Power PC G5, Intel-based Mac, 512MB RAM
• Mac OS X 10.4.11 PowerPC G4, G5 or Intel-based Mac, 256MB RAM
• Windows Vista Ultimate, Business, Home (Service Pack 1) * 800 MHz or faster, 512 MB RAM, SVGA graphics card and monitor with a resolution of 1024 x 768 pixels
• Windows XP Professional, Home Edition (Service Pack 3) Pentium III 700MHz or faster, 256MB RAM, SVGA graphics card and monitor with a resolution of 1024 x 768 pixels
Compatibility
FileMaker Pro 10 and FileMaker Pro 10 Advanced use the same database format (. Fp7) as FileMaker Pro 9 and FileMaker Pro 9 Advanced and FileMaker Pro 8.x / FileMaker Pro 8 Advanced. Therefore, they can easily share databases between these applications. FileMaker Pro 7 and FileMaker Developer 7 are no longer supported - even if use of these two products the same FileMaker database format. The reason is that both FileMaker Pro 7 and have achieved FileMaker Developer 7, the end of their service life.
Features of the newer versions of FileMaker are supported only by them; for example, script triggers and the e-mail sending function via SMTP features of FileMaker Pro 10 and FileMaker Pro 10 Advanced and are only supported by them.
Additional requirements (all platforms)
Network protocol: TCP / IP: limited to nine simultaneous FileMaker client connections, each user must have a properly licensed copy of software available, allows more simultaneous connections FileMaker Server 10 FileMaker Pro 10 supports Internet Protocol version 6 (IPv6) addresses and IPv4 addresses.
Computer accessing FileMaker Pro files require a properly licensed and installed FileMaker Pro or FileMaker Pro Advanced 8.x, 9 or 10 FileMaker Pro 7 and FileMaker Developer 7 use the same file format as though FileMaker Pro 10 and FileMaker Pro 10 Advanced, are not supported, because they have reached their product life cycle.
Instant Web Publishing: A host computer with continuous Internet or intranet access with TCP / IP. (FileMaker Pro 10 and FileMaker Pro 10 Advanced manage up to five simultaneous Instant Web Publishing sessions, more concurrent connections enables FileMaker Server 10
Web browser: a database shared with Instant Web Publishing users use a common browser such as Microsoft Internet Explorer version 7.0 or Firefox 3.0. Mac users need Safari 3.1.2 or Firefox 3.0. On both platforms, earlier versions of Internet Explorer and Safari are blocked. Other Mozilla family browsers are not blocked but not supported by FileMaker. Users of these browsers are encouraged to upgrade to the latest browser version. JavaScript must be enabled in your web browser.
